Default Changing ignition on 1999 Mustang

I had to take my son's 1999 Ford Mustang from him as he wasn't making his payments (and the loan is in my name). Since he has both sets of keys, what can I do to change out the ignition so he can't just take it? What parts do I need and will it be very expensive. Thanks in advance for your help.

Default RE: Changing ignition on 1999 Mustang

You'll need to reprogram the computer. The ignition lock, door locks, and trunk lock, mechanically, aren't too difficult. The computer is a different story. You'll have to go through a Ford dealership to reprogram keys, to the tune of probably $150 or so for each key (price will vary, of course).
